Description
Position Overview The PRP Counselor provides psychiatric rehabilitation services to clients with mental health diagnoses. Services focus on skill-building, community integration, treatment planning, and promoting independence and stability. Minimum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Psychology, Social Work, Counseling, or related field 1+ year experience in behavioral health (preferred) Knowledge of PRP documentation requirements Valid driver’s license & reliable transportation Ability to work independently in community settings Key Responsibilities Conduct assessments and develop Individual Rehabilitation Plans (IRPs) Provide community-based skill-building sessions Maintain timely and compliant documentation Collaborate with therapists, psychiatrists, and case managers Assist clients with employment, education, and daily living skills Attend supervision and team meetings Ideal candidate demonstrates: Strong documentation skills Empathy and professionalism Crisis management awareness Ability to manage caseload efficiently Cultural competency Pay rate: $25-30
